Nuclear and related analytical techniques for life sciences
Place and role of nuclear analytical techniques (NATs) in life sciences is discussed. Examples of radioanalytical investigations at the IBR-2 pulsed fast reactor in Dubna illustrate the environmental, biomedical, geochemical and industrial applications of instrumental neutron activation analysis.
